androidstudio build.gradle.kts中plugin
时间: 2024-09-22 17:03:47 浏览: 22
在Android Studio的`build.gradle.kts`文件中,`plugins`部分是用来配置项目所使用的Gradle插件的。Gradle插件是一组预定义的功能,它们扩展了Gradle的能力,帮助我们处理各种Android构建任务,如编译、依赖管理、构建工具集成等。
`plugins`关键字后通常跟着一系列的语句,例如:
```kotlin
plugins {
id("com.android.application") version "7.0.4" // 官方Android应用插件
kotlin("jvm") version "1.6.20" // Kotlin JVM 插件
}
```
这里列举几个常见的插件:
1. `id("com.android.application")` 或 `id("com.android.library")`:用于Android应用程序或库项目的构建。
2. `kotlin-android` 或 `kotlin-kapt`:用于Kotlin语言支持,包括编译器插件和注解处理器(Annotate Processing Tool,APT)。
3. `com.google.gms.google-services`: Google Play Services插件,用于集成Google服务。
添加插件时,需要指定ID(由Gradle组织提供)和版本号。每次更新项目或引入新功能时,可能需要检查并更新相应的插件版本。
相关问题
android studio build.gradle.kts
对于Android Studio的build.gradle.kts文件,可以参考以下内容:
在该文件中,可以配置项目的构建设置和依赖项。在顶级build.gradle.kts文件中,可以添加项目的构建脚本和配置选项。通常,它包括一个buildscript块,用于指定gradle执行所需的依赖项和仓库路径。该文件还包含allprojects块,用于指定项目的依赖项和仓库路径。
在build.gradle.kts文件中,可以使用dependencies块来添加您的应用程序所需的依赖项。请注意,在build.gradle.kts文件中,不应将应用程序的依赖项放在dependencies块中,而是应放在单独的模块的build.gradle.kts文件中。
此外,build.gradle.kts文件还包括其他任务或脚本,例如clean任务,用于清理项目构建目录。
总结起来,build.gradle.kts文件用于配置项目的构建设置和依赖项,包括构建脚本、依赖项和其他任务。可以使用gradle的DSL(领域特定语言)来编写这个文件。
请参考和了解更多关于build.gradle.kts文件的详细信息和示例配置。
android studio把build.gradle.kts
引用[1]:BuildType是指在build.gradle文件中的android.buildTypes配置中的一部分。它用于定义不同的构建类型,例如debug和release。[1]引用[2]:LibraryExtension是指在build.gradle文件中的android配置中的一部分。它用于配置库项目的特定属性和行为。[2]引用[3]:CmakeOptions是指在build.gradle文件中的android.defaultConfig.externalNativeBuild.cmake配置中的一部分。它用于配置CMake构建选项。[3]
问题:android studio把build.gradle.kts文件转换成了什么文件?
回答: 在Android Studio中,build.gradle.kts文件被转换成了build.gradle文件。build.gradle文件是使用Groovy语言编写的脚本文件,用于配置和构建Android项目。在转换过程中,build.gradle.kts文件中的配置和属性被转换成相应的Groovy语法。这样,Android Studio可以正确解析和执行这些配置和属性,以构建和编译Android应用程序。